General description

Pramipexole belongs to non-ergoline class and is derived from benzothiazole. It has strong affinity for D2 and D3 receptors (dopamine receptors) compared to other ergoline-derived drugs. However, it does not associate with non-dopamine receptors, for instance adrenergic and serotonin receptors.

Application

Pramipexole dihydrochloride has been used as D2 receptor agonist in dopamine (DA)-depleted striatum slices.[1]
Pramipexole dihydrochloride has been used as a D2-like DR (dopaminergic receptor) agonist in study associated with Parkinson′s disease.[2] It has also been used as a D2/D3 receptor agonist to study risky decision-making in rats.[3]

Biochem/physiol Actions

Pramipexole dihydrochloride monohydrate is a dopamine agonist active at D3 and D2 receptor subtypes.
Pramipexole elicits neuroprotective role and may help in treating depression.[4] It also has a potential to modulate limb movement and may be effective in treating restless legs syndrome.[5]
Pramipexole is a dopamine agonist active at D3 and D2 receptor subtypes. Pramipexole has been found to have neuroprotective effects independent of its dopamine receptor agonism. It reduces mitochondrial reactive oxygen species (ROS) production and inhibits the activation of apoptotic pathways.
Pramipexole is a therapeutic agent for Parkinson′s disease and restless leg syndrome. It also exhibits antidepressant responses in patients suffering from MDD (major depressive disorder) and bipolar depression.[6]

  1. Is this pramipexole the pure L enantiomer? Or a racemic mixture of L and R? If pure enantiomer: 1.  how was this determined and 2. are the data supporting this available?

    1 answer
    1. Pramipexole dihydrochloride (A1237) is described with the synonym (S)-2-amino-4,5,6,7-tetrahydro-6-(propylamino)benzothiazole dihydrochloride, indicating it is the S (L) enantiomer. The optical rotation is measured and can be found in the Certificate of Analysis (COA) for this product. The specification for this product is between -60° and -70°, which is consistent with the S (L) enantiomer of pramipexole.
